Jessica in the 'No One Killed Jessica' true story was Jessica Lall, a model in Delhi. She was the victim of a senseless murder at a party.
The 'No One Killed Jessica' is based on the real - life story of Jessica Lall, a model in Delhi, India. She was working at a party when she was shot dead because she refused to serve alcohol after hours. The case initially saw the accused getting away due to influence and a bungled investigation. But later, due to public outcry and the tenacious efforts of Jessica's sister, Sabrina Lall, justice was finally served.

Jessica Lynch's true story is an eye - opener. She was part of the military operations in Iraq. Initially, the media painted a picture of her being this super - heroic figure who endured great odds in combat before being captured. However, the truth was that her vehicle crashed. She was severely injured in that accident and then taken prisoner. When it came to her rescue, it was also presented in a more glamorous and heroic light than what really occurred. This whole situation highlights the importance of getting accurate information and not just believing the first version of a story that is presented, especially when it comes to military and political situations where there can be motives to distort the truth.
